How Much Does It Cost To Clear Wrap A Car 

If you are looking to clear wrap your car in the UK, the cost will depend on a few factors. The main factor is the size of the car. A small car will cost less to clear wrap than a large SUV. Another factor is the level of difficulty. If you have a lot of chrome trim on your car, it will take longer to clear wrap and will therefore cost more. The final factor is the quality of the vinyl used. Higher quality vinyl will last longer and will not fade as quickly, so it will cost more up front but may save you money in the long run.

To give you a general idea, expect to pay anywhere from £200 to £1,000 to clear wrap your car in the UK.

How Much Does It Cost To Chrome Delete a Car

Chrome is a common and popular finish for car trim, but it's not to everyone's taste. If you're looking to remove the chrome from your car, there are a few things you need to know.

First of all, it's important to know that chrome delete is not a cheap process. Depending on the extent of the work required, it can cost anywhere from £500 to over £1000. This is because chrome delete involves sanding down the existing chrome finish and then painting over it. As you can imagine, this is a time-consuming and labour-intensive process.

Secondly, it's worth noting that chrome delete is not reversible. Once the existing chrome has been removed, there's no going back. So if you're thinking about doing this to your car, be sure that you're happy with the results before you commit.

Finally, bear in mind that chrome delete will affect the value of your car. While some people may prefer the look of a car without chrome, others may see it as a negative modification. As such, it's something to consider carefully before going ahead with the work.

What Does Dechrome a car mean?

Dechroming a car means to remove or reduce the amount of chrome on the car. This can be done for aesthetic reasons or to make the car more aerodynamic. There are a few ways to dechrome a car, including painting, powder coating, and using a vinyl wrap. The cost of dechroming a car will vary depending on the method used and the size of the car.
